Efforts on to release four policemen from naxal captivity in Chhattisgarh

In Chhattisgarh, efforts are on for the safe release of the four policemen from naxal captivity. It may be mentioned here that naxalites had abducted 7 policemen form near Bhadrakali under Bijapur district about a week ago. They had subsequently killed three of them.
